Safe Haskell | None |
---|---|
Language | Haskell2010 |
Synopsis
- handleContractStore :: forall dbt a effs. (FromBackendRow dbt Text, FromBackendRow dbt Bool, FromBackendRow dbt SqlNull, HasSqlValueSyntax (Synt dbt) (Maybe Text), HasSqlValueSyntax (Synt dbt) Text, HasSqlValueSyntax (Synt dbt) Bool, HasSqlEqualityCheck dbt Text, HasSqlEqualityCheck dbt Bool, HasQBuilder dbt, Member (BeamEffect dbt) effs, Member (Error PABError) effs, Member (LogMsg (PABMultiAgentMsg (Builtin a))) effs, ToJSON a, FromJSON a, HasDefinitions a, Typeable a) => ContractStore (Builtin a) ~> Eff effs
Documentation
handleContractStore :: forall dbt a effs. (FromBackendRow dbt Text, FromBackendRow dbt Bool, FromBackendRow dbt SqlNull, HasSqlValueSyntax (Synt dbt) (Maybe Text), HasSqlValueSyntax (Synt dbt) Text, HasSqlValueSyntax (Synt dbt) Bool, HasSqlEqualityCheck dbt Text, HasSqlEqualityCheck dbt Bool, HasQBuilder dbt, Member (BeamEffect dbt) effs, Member (Error PABError) effs, Member (LogMsg (PABMultiAgentMsg (Builtin a))) effs, ToJSON a, FromJSON a, HasDefinitions a, Typeable a) => ContractStore (Builtin a) ~> Eff effs Source #
Run the ContractStore
actions against the database.